DEBORAH SHUMAKER

FOUNDER

After 30 years in the banking industry, Deborah Shumaker has transitioned into a second career focusing on advising banks and companies. Her consulting company, Card Avenue, advises on implementing a sales culture, streamlining operations, and adding treasury management services.
 

The first 15 years in Deb’s banking career were spent at PNC Bank in Pittsburgh, PA, starting in the branches, and moving along to different segments, including treasury management and brokerage.
 

In 2005 Deb moved to the Washington D.C. area, where she began her business development career. The opportunity of going to D.C. fell into her lap when PNC relocated her with their merger with Riggs Bank. From there, she broke out of her comfort zone into community banking at EagleBank. There, she started and led their Cash Management Department and Business Development Team, and soon became heavily involved with bank operations.
 

Over the next 10 years, business development became Deb's passion. Prospecting for new business opportunities quickly became a "game" (making it ‘fun’). It was a game of seeing how many prospect- doors she could get into by cold contacting small & medium-sized companies and national nonprofits- a method she also taught to her sales team.
 

Through the years, it had become apparent to Deb that many sales people didn't know how to prospect and identify new business opportunities. It wasn't necessarily their fault, however, as they often lacked seasoned role models, leadership, and a sales culture to support them in their banks.

 

Some company leaders assume that a sales person "just knows" what to do in order to bring in new
business, and that nothing special is needed from the organization to help them succeed -- Nothing could be further from the truth.

 

Solid operations and streamlined processes also play key roles in the success of running a business.  Overlooking the soundness of these structural foundations could make or break a business’ potential of sustainability and growth.
 

Deb has designed methods of implementing a true sales culture from the top - down, improving operations and processes, and is a seasoned banker when it comes to treasury management services.
